Dvořák: Piano Trio in G Minor, Op. 26Composer: Antonn Dvok (1841 1904) Editor: Antonn Pokorn Format: Set of Parts Instrumentation: Piano Trio (Piano, Violin, Cello) Work: Piano Trio No. 2 in G Minor, B. 56, Op. 26 Binding: ISMN: 9790260105546 Size: 10. 0 x 12. 2 inches Pages: 76 Urtext Critical Edition Description Dvok wrote a total of four works for piano trio.
